Product: Profile Racing – 14mm Elite Hubs – Out Now

March 20, 2014

Profile-Elite-14mm-Rear-1200-1024x765

Here it is! We got our first look at these 14mm Elite hubs from Profile Racing last month at Frostbike, and now they’re available for everyone! The Elite hub is CNC machined right here in the U.S out of aluminum and features a ratchet ring with a one-piece chromoly 9 or 10 tooth driver with 6 pawls creating 204 points of engagement and sounds like a swarm of bees when you are riding and 5 sealed bearings to keep you rolling smooth. Now they have added the option of running a 14mm male axle for those of you who want to run the hub, but would also like to grind without the fear of wrecking the female axles.

You can pick this hub up in right or left side drive with colors of black, polished, matte black, red, blue, gold, green, purple, white and aqua for right side drive or in black and polished with only a 9-tooth driver option for left side drive (for now) or for existing Elite hub owners, a 14mm conversion kit has been made available that includes the axle, cones and jam nuts.

Product: Subrosa – Limited Edition Silva II Frame

March 20, 2014

SubrosaSilvaFL_000_600x

Subrosa‘s Mark Mulville wanted to do something special for the release of his Silva II frame. So they teamed up with his sponsor, Emmitt BMX to do a special colorway and sticker kit that turned out so rad.
The Silva II is a full 4130 chromoly frame with a 75.5-degree head tube angle, 71-degree seat tube angle, 9″ stand over height, 11.6″ bottom bracket height and a 13.50″ – 14″ chain stay length. This frame has a heat treated head tube, bottom bracket and drop outs, double butted top and down tubes, a gusset on the down tube, curved seat and chain stay bridges for bigger tire clearance, flattened stays at the drop outs for hub guard clearance, removable brake mounts and an integrated seat post clamp. You can pick this frame up in 20.5″, 20.75″ and 21″ top tube sizes with the limited edition translucent black colorway with special graphics. More photos RIGHT HERE.

This frame is going for $289.99 exclusively through Emmitt BMX.

The Silva II is also available in chrome and smoke black everywhere else Subrosa is sold. Have your local shop hit up Sparky’s Distribution or hit up Dan’s Comp.

Sneak Peek: Shape Bicycles – Seat Post Clamp

March 18, 2014

SHAPE_BICYCLES_SEATCLAMP

It’s been a while since we’ve seen any sort of special focus on the seat post clamp on a bike. It’s a very basic part, but there are plenty of things that can be done to make it unique. Shape Bicycles over in France have been working on their new clamp for a little while now and decided it would be cool to show you what they’re working on. This clamp is made from AG3 aluminum and is cut using a water jet, which believe it or not is less expensive than actual CNC machining. After that, they gave it some chemical engraving for both styles of logos on the front, and the Shape logo on the top in the back. Finally, they sand and polish each clamp by hand giving it that clean look and slide in the M5 stainless steel bolt to keep that post of yours tight.

This clamp is still in prototype stages, so it currently is unavailable, but I would assume they will be out soon.
